WHAT DO YOU HAVE TO DO TO BE AN INDIVIDUAL?
That is the question at the heart of existentialism and it informs this book’s exploration of the existentialist tradition in 19th and 20th century philosophy.

Existentialism: All That Matters considers each of the key figures – Kierkegaard, Nietzsche, Heidegger, Sartre, Camus and de Beauvoir – who all offer related, though distinct, conceptions of the task of becoming an individual.

David Cerbone’s book gives a fascinating introduction to existentialism and what matters most about it.
